[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]I just traveled through 6 regions of Italy (this is my 4th trip to Italy). I have never once been pickpocketed there, or anywhere in Europe. If in cities, I have a crossbody with a zip top. If more rural, a backpack. Worn on my back, not my front. And backpack worn in traveling through places like train stations, etc. Most important is just being a sensible person that has a sense of awareness. Don't linger, walk with a purpose, and don't leave you bag on the floor when you stop to sit somewhere. Just be practical.[/quote] Being practical is not enough. You have to teflon yourself, especially because who wants to be on high alert at all times while relaxing on vacation? It's the opposite of fun. So make it so that even when you're having fun, get distracted (because you will be distracted at some point, possibly by thieves if not by your own fault) you're not a target because you have no easily accessible, visible anything on your person.[/quote]
